2 Esdras 2:1-7

1 "Thus says the Lord: I brought this people out of bondage, and I gave them commandments through my servants the prophets; but they would not listen to them, and made my counsels void.
2 The mother who bore them says to them, "Go, my children, because I am a widow and forsaken.
3 I brought you up with gladness; but with mourning and sorrow I have lost you, because you have sinned before the Lord God and have done what is evil in my sight.
4 But now what can I do for you? For I am a widow and forsaken. Go, my children, and ask for mercy from the Lord.'
5 Now I call upon you, father, as a witness in addition to the mother of the children, because they would not keep my covenant,
6 so that you may bring confusion on them and bring their mother to ruin, so that they may have no offspring.
7 Let them be scattered among the nations; let their names be blotted out from the earth, because they have despised my covenant.
